Understanding University Road Hoarding Dynamics

University road hoarding location strategies differ fundamentally from standard billboard advertising approaches. These educational corridors create unique marketing ecosystems where audiences demonstrate specific behavioral patterns. Students walk or cycle past the same hoardings twice daily during term time, creating repetition frequencies that traditional outdoor advertising locations struggle to match. Faculty members, visiting parents, and local residents add demographic diversity while delivery vehicles, food service providers, and campus maintenance crews ensure weekday traffic remains consistent.

The positioning of outdoor advertising near universities offers several distinct advantages. First, the audience skews younger and more educated, with disposable income increasingly available through part-time employment and parental support. Second, universities attract international students, creating opportunities for brands with global reach or specific cultural targeting. Third, the surrounding commercial infrastructure typically includes cafes, accommodation, bookshops, and entertainment venues where students make daily purchasing decisions.

Traffic flow analysis around university roads reveals morning peaks between 8:00-10:00 AM and afternoon concentrations from 3:00-6:00 PM, with mid-morning periods maintaining steady pedestrian volumes as students move between lectures. Unlike commercial districts where weekend traffic drops significantly, university areas maintain Saturday activity through sports events, library usage, and social gatherings. Strategic Positioning Considerations for Maximum Impact

Selecting the optimal university road hoarding location requires understanding sight lines, approach angles, and environmental factors that influence visibility. Hoardings positioned on the driver's side of traffic flow receive 43% more attention than those requiring cross-traffic viewing, according to outdoor advertising research. Corner positions at major intersections near university entrances command premium pricing but deliver exponentially higher impressions as vehicles slow for turns and pedestrians wait at crossings.

The distance between the hoarding and the road significantly impacts readability. Industry standards suggest that for every foot of letter height, viewers need 50 feet of viewing distance. A hoarding positioned 30 feet from a road with 12-inch letters remains readable, but the same hoarding at 60 feet requires 24-inch letters for equivalent impact. University roads typically feature slower traffic speeds of 20-30 mph, allowing for more complex messaging compared to highway billboards where seven words represents the maximum effective message length.

Surrounding visual competition affects hoarding effectiveness dramatically. A strategically positioned unit near a plain brick university building will outperform a similar hoarding surrounded by retail signage, even with identical traffic counts. Smart media buyers assess the visual environment during site visits, considering seasonal factors like tree foliage that might obscure summer visibility or construction projects that could temporarily redirect traffic flow.

Proximity to decision points amplifies campaign effectiveness. A hoarding advertising food delivery services positioned 200 meters before student accommodation blocks capitalizes on hunger-driven impulse decisions. Technology brands benefit from placements near engineering and computer science buildings, while financial services messages resonate when positioned along routes toward business schools. Audience Demographics and Targeting Opportunities

University road hoarding location campaigns reach audiences with remarkable demographic consistency. UK universities report that 68% of students fall within the 18-24 age bracket, with postgraduate populations extending reach into the 25-34 demographic. This audience demonstrates higher-than-average smartphone ownership, social media engagement, and openness to brand messaging compared to general populations.

The socioeconomic profile varies by institution type. Russell Group universities attract students from higher-income households, with 42% coming from families earning above median national income. Modern universities and colleges draw more diverse socioeconomic backgrounds, creating opportunities for brands with broader market positioning. International student populations at major universities often exceed 30%, with significant concentrations from China, India, Nigeria, and EU countries, making university road hoardings valuable for brands targeting these specific cultural groups.

Faculty and staff represent an often-overlooked secondary audience with substantially different purchasing power. University employees typically earn above-average incomes and make decisions regarding family purchases, financial services, automotive needs, and property. A 20,000-student university employs approximately 3,000-5,000 staff members who travel past the same hoardings daily, creating sustained exposure among this valuable demographic.

Local residents living near universities include young professionals, families, and retirees who benefit from proximity to cultural events and facilities. These communities often feature higher education levels and property values compared to city-wide averages. Media buyers targeting educated, affluent households find university road hoarding locations deliver concentrated reach within these desirable segments.

Seasonal Considerations and Campaign Timing

University road hoarding location effectiveness fluctuates dramatically across the academic calendar, requiring strategic campaign timing. Term time delivers maximum student exposure, with September-December and January-May representing peak periods. Traffic volumes during these months can exceed summer levels by 60-80% along routes directly serving campus facilities.

The September return represents particular opportunity as students establish new routines, open bank accounts, sign phone contracts, and develop brand loyalties that persist throughout their academic careers. Brands targeting freshers should secure hoarding inventory for late August through October, positioning messages to capture this receptive audience during their orientation period. Reading weeks, typically scheduled in February and November, see reduced weekday traffic but create opportunities for messages targeting leisure activities and travel services. Students remaining on campus during these periods demonstrate different behavioral patterns, with increased daytime availability and receptiveness to entertainment and hospitality messaging.

Summer presents complicated opportunities. While student populations decline by 70-90% at most institutions, summer schools, international programs, and conference activities maintain meaningful traffic. Hoardings along university roads during summer months often command reduced pricing while still delivering valuable exposure to tourists, local residents, and remaining academic staff. Brands with longer planning horizons can negotiate favorable annual rates that average costs across high and low seasons.

Integration with Digital and Mobile Strategies

Modern university road hoarding location campaigns achieve maximum effectiveness when integrated with digital touchpoints. Students passing outdoor advertisements subsequently engage with brands through smartphone research, with 67% of university-age consumers reporting they search for products immediately after seeing outdoor advertising. Including QR codes, unique URLs, or social media handles on hoarding creative transforms passive impressions into measurable digital interactions.

Geofencing technology allows advertisers to trigger mobile advertisements when smartphones enter defined zones around hoarding locations. A student walking past a hoarding advertising a clothing brand can receive a complementary Instagram ad within minutes, reinforcing the message through multiple channels. This integration delivers measurably higher conversion rates than either channel operating independently.

Social media amplification occurs organically when hoarding creative features shareable content. University students frequently photograph and share clever, humorous, or culturally relevant advertising, extending reach far beyond physical impressions. Campaigns incorporating university-specific references, local humor, or student concerns generate user-generated content that amplifies investment value substantially.

Measuring Success and Return on Investment

University road hoarding location campaigns deliver measurable results through multiple metrics. Traffic counts provide baseline impression data, with automated systems now offering hourly breakdowns showing exact exposure patterns. The average university road hoarding generates 180,000-320,000 weekly impressions depending on positioning and traffic flow, translating to 2.3-4.2 million impressions across a standard 12-week term.

Brand lift studies conducted around university advertising consistently show recall rates of 64-71% among frequent passers-by, significantly exceeding the 42-48% recall typical of general outdoor advertising locations. This elevated performance reflects the repetition frequency inherent in university commuting patterns and the extended dwell times common along these routes.

Conversion tracking through unique promotional codes, dedicated landing pages, or geofenced mobile advertising provides direct attribution data. Brands advertising student discounts or university-specific offers can track redemption rates precisely, calculating exact cost-per-acquisition figures that demonstrate hoarding effectiveness.
